Reimbursement and Discounting
Insurance coverage, PBMs (Pharmacy Benefit Managers), and negotiated discounts influence actual transaction prices. The introduction of biosimilars or generic competitors can reduce net prices by 20-40% or more within 3-5 years post-patent expiration.

2. How does biosimilar entry affect the pricing of drugs like NDC 00781-5828?
Biosimilar entry generally leads to significant price reductions, often by 20-50%, as competition increases and payors negotiate better rebate terms.

4. How important are market exclusivity periods in pricing projections?
Extensive market exclusivity, through patents or orphan drug status, enables prolonged premium pricing, delaying generic or biosimilar competition.
